Industrial roof replacement services involve removing and replacing aging or damaged roofing systems on large-scale commercial properties. This process typically includes assessing the existing roof, removing the old materials, and installing a new, durable roofing membrane designed to withstand the demands of industrial environments. Contractors specializing in this service utilize various techniques and materials to ensure the new roof provides long-term protection against weather, wear, and structural stress. The goal is to restore the integrity of the roof, preventing leaks and other issues that could compromise the safety and functionality of the facility.
One of the primary issues that industrial roof replacement addresses is roof deterioration caused by age, weather exposure, or structural fatigue. Over time, roofs may develop leaks, cracks, or weakened areas that threaten the interior spaces and equipment housed within the building. Replacing a roof can eliminate persistent leaks, prevent water intrusion, and reduce the risk of structural damage. Additionally, a new roof can improve energy efficiency by providing better insulation and reflective properties, which may lead to lower utility costs and enhanced operational efficiency.

Contractors offering industrial roof replacement services work with a variety of roofing materials suited for commercial and industrial applications. Common options include built-up roofing (BUR), single-ply membranes like TPO or EPDM, metal roofing, and spray-applied coatings. The choice of material depends on factors such as the building’s structure, environmental conditions, and budget considerations. Project Costs - The cost for industrial roof replacement typically ranges from $5,000 to $25,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. Smaller facilities may see costs closer to the lower end, while larger warehouses can reach higher estimates. Local pros can provide detailed quotes based on specific needs.
Material Expenses - Material prices for roof replacement vary widely, with common options like metal costing between $7 and $12 per square foot. EPDM rubber or other membranes may range from $4 to $9 per square foot. Material selection influences overall project costs significantly.
Labor Estimates - Labor costs for industrial roof replacement generally fall between $2 and $6 per square foot. Factors such as roof height, accessibility, and existing conditions can impact labor charges. Contractors can assess site-specific factors to provide accurate estimates.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include permits, debris removal, and structural repairs, which can add 10-20% to the total project price. These fees vary based on local regulations and the scope of work required. Local service providers can clarify potential additional expenses during consultation.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the signs that an industrial roof needs replacement? Indicators include persistent leaks, extensive roof surface damage, visible mold or mildew, and age-related deterioration that cannot be repaired effectively.
How long does an industrial roof replacement typ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and complexity of the roof, but most projects are completed within a few days to a few weeks.
What materials are commonly used for industrial roof replacements? Common options include metal roofing, built-up roofing (BUR), modified bitumen, and single-ply membranes like TPO or PVC.
Are there any preparations needed before a roof replacement begins? Yes, contractors may need access to the roof area, and it’s recommended to clear the surrounding space of obstacles to facilitate safe and efficient work.
